Technical Specification: Material Excellence

The Teak Standard (Myanmar vs. South America)

Teak (Tectona grandis) is renowned for its high oil content and tight grain. At JIANGYIREN, we specialize in Grade-A Teak. Unlike B or C grade, Grade-A comes from the heartwood of mature trees, offering natural resistance to termites and rot without the need for chemical treatments. This makes our furniture ideal for luxury residential projects where longevity and safety are paramount.

The Aluminum Advantage

Our aluminum frames are engineered with a wall thickness of 1.2mm to 2.0mm, depending on structural requirements. The "Willow" sets utilize aluminum for the core structure, providing a rust-proof foundation that is lightweight yet capable of supporting over 200kg per seat. The powder coating is applied electrostatically and cured under high heat to ensure a bond that will not chip or fade under intense UV exposure.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Expert Insights into Procurement & Maintenance

Q1: What makes South American A-grade teak different from standard garden furniture wood?

A1: South American Grade-A teak is harvested from managed plantations and selected for its high silica and oil content. This provides inherent waterproofing and durability that cheaper woods (like Acacia or Eucalyptus) cannot match. It matures into a beautiful silver-grey patina if left untreated, or maintains a rich gold with simple oiling.

Q2: Can the willow-style weaving withstand extreme temperatures?

A2: Yes. Our willow-style sets use HDPE (High-Density Polyethylene) synthetic wicker. Unlike natural willow which can brittle and crack, HDPE is tested to withstand temperatures from -20°C to +55°C without warping or losing color vibrancy.
